Tinubu’s Local Govt Directorate In Campaign Council Hailed by Majesty2(m): 7:40am On Sep 29, 2022
Local government chairmen across the country have hailed All Progressives Congress (APC) presidential candidate Asiwaju Bola Ahmed Tinubu and his running mate, Senator Kashim Shettima, for creating local government directorate in the Presidential Campaign Council (PCC) of the APC.
They described the action as historic and a masterstroke.
The council bosses said having a directorate for local government in the PCC was a laudable initiative.
The APC PCC list included local government directorate among other directorates with the inclusion of local governments’ practitioners as director, deputy director and secretary.
The Chairman of Bariga Local Council Development Area in Lagos State, Kolade David Alabi, was named director, his counterparts at Lafia Local Government, Nasarawa State and Dutse Local Government, Jigawa State, Aminu Muazu Maitafa and Bala Usman Chamo were appointed as deputy director and secretary.
The duo said: “In a communiqué issued at the end of the 32nd National Executive Council (NEC) Meeting of the Association of Local Governments of Nigeria (ALGON), held on September 1 in Lokoja, Kogi State, it was stated that ‘with respect to the 2023 general election, ALGON will support and give its commitment to any presidential candidate that is committed to the actualisation of full local government autonomy.’”
The APC, they said, had displayed a commitment to their cause.
“No doubt, the ruling party has once again demonstrated its love and determination to ensure the growth of local government administration in the country.
“President Muhammadu Buhari has since the inception of his administration not hidden his feelings to see that the local government administration in the country gets its rightful place through moves to make them truly autonomous.
“We are assuring the APC Presidential Campaign Council led by President Buhari and the party’s standard-bearer, Asiwaju Tinubu and Senator Shettima of our resolve to mobilise local governments across the country to ensure APC wins the presidential election,” the duo said.

Second Niger Bridge: Buhari’s Iconic Gift To South-East Region
Business | 6 months ago
Ifeanyi Onuba

The handing over of the project by Obasanjo to Yar’ Adua made his administration to effectively inherit a ₦58.6bn proposed cost for a six lane, 1.8 km tolled bridge, which was to be completed in three-and-half years.

Based on the funding structure then, the bridge was to be financed under a public private partnership (PPP) with 60 per cent of the funding coming from the contractor, Gitto Group; 20 per cent from the federal government and 10 per cent from the Anambra and Delta State Governments.

Unfortunately, the subsequent death of Yar’ Adua on May 5, 2010 marred the progress of the project. However, in August 2012, the Federal Executive Council under the administration of Goodluck Jonathan, approved a contract worth ₦325m for the final planning and design of the bridge.

Before then, during the 2011 general election in Nigeria, Jonathan had while campaigning for office of the President promised that if elected, he would deliver the project before the end of his term in 2015.


At an Onitsha town hall meeting on August 30, 2012, Jonathan had sworn to go into exile if he did not deliver on the project by 2015.

The act of rigmarole where the Second Niger bridge was used as a major political pawn continued until Buhari first cancelled the earlier contract in August 2015.

The project was subsequently awarded to Julius Berger for a contract sum of N206bn, to be implemented by the Nigerian Sovereign Investment Authority with funding from the Presidential Infrastructure Development Fund.
